mummification /mum·mi·fi·ca·tion/ (mum?i-fi-ka´shun) the shriveling up of a tissue, as in dry gangrene, or of a dead, retained fetus.
mummification conversion to a dehydrated state; commonly said of a fetus. The soft tissues are very much reduced in volume, the skin is leathery and the tissues are deeply brown-stained. corneal mummification see corneal sequestrum. |
